BofA is staying bullish on the memory trade, arguing that Chinese open-source AI models strengthen the long-term demand case for $MU, $SKHY, $SNDK, $STX, and $WDC. The firm reiterated its Buy rating on Micron $MU with a $1,550 price target, saying cheaper Chinese model pricing does not mean lower hardware intensity. BofA notes Kimi K3 API pricing is reportedly 5x–350x below Western models, but says that reflects business-model choices rather than the true cost of compute infrastructure. The firm also highlights that Kimi K3 needs roughly 1.4TB of HBM per serving instance, while larger AI models should require the same or even more memory as weights and active parameters grow. BofA also sees CXMT focused on commodity DRAM rather than advanced HBM, and notes Micron’s CHIPS Act restrictions may expire around December 2026, potentially opening the door for $50B–$60B in annual buybacks. 3. Supermicro $SMCI gave a major preliminary update after hours. Fiscal Q4 revenue is expected to land near the low end of its $11B–$12.5B guidance range, but the bigger surprise is gross margin, now expected at 15%–17% versus the prior 8.2%–8.4% forecast. Last quarter, SMCI was guiding gross margins around 8.4%–8.7%, and its TTM gross margin is only 8.83%, making this a dramatic improvement in just 90 days. The company also said it received more than $60B in new orders during the quarter, pushing backlog to a record high, though some orders could still be delayed or canceled. CoreWeave $CRWV says near-term profitability is being weighed down by a timing mismatch in its AI infrastructure rollout. New capacity starts depreciating roughly six weeks before contracted customer revenue begins coming in, creating pressure on reported earnings. The company is carrying about $30B of debt to fund 49 operating data centers and future deployments, with depreciation and interest equal to 81% of Q1 revenue. CEO Michael Intrator expects that drag to lessen as more installed capacity converts into revenue. CoreWeave’s financing is supported by long-term customer contracts, where clients must pay for reserved capacity whether they use it or not. 12. Short interest across U.S. equities is climbing to extreme levels. In the S&P 500, short interest has risen to roughly 3.7% of free float, near the highest level in data going back to 2010. For the Russell 3000, short interest is around 6.1%, also close to an all-time high, with both measures steadily moving higher since the start of 2025. Across all NYSE-listed stocks, short interest reached a record 9.0% of shares outstanding in late June. Google $GOOGL is developing a new AI chip that could run Gemini models 6x to 10x more efficiently than its latest TPUs, per The Information. The chip, internally called “Frozen v2,” would bake parts of Gemini’s architecture directly into silicon, reducing data movement and simplifying inference decisions. Google is targeting deployment as early as 2028 to help ease its AI compute shortage, though the design would trade flexibility for major gains in speed and power efficiency. 2. AUM in U.S. leveraged semiconductor ETFs has fallen $63B from the June peak to $100B, the lowest level since late April. That marks a 39% decline, the largest drawdown since April 2025, when assets more than halved from their August high. The semiconductor unwind accounts for 63% of the broader $100B drop in AUM across all U.S. leveraged ETFs over the same period. The selloff follows a massive ramp, with assets in these funds nearly tripling between late March and the June peak. Even after the pullback, leveraged semiconductor ETF assets are still up 400% from January 2023 levels. 4. Chinese AI models are taking record share among U.S. firms on OpenRouter. The proportion of tokens used by American companies running through Chinese models has climbed to roughly 58%, a record high. OpenRouter lets developers access and compare models from multiple providers, making it a useful real-world signal of AI model adoption. Chinese model usage has tripled since mid-January, overtaking U.S. peers on the platform for the first time in March and briefly hitting 63% in early July. At the start of 2025, Chinese models were under 10% of usage, while U.S. models were around 80%. DeepSeek has become the most popular choice among American firms in recent months. 6. Mizuho Securities: CPUs & GPUs Market Forecasts & Growth > Shipment Growth: Industry server CPU shipments are forecasted to reach 35 million units in 2026 and grow to 50 million units by 2027, representing a 40% year-over-year increase. > Long-Term TAM: The long-term Total Addressable Market (TAM) estimate for 2030 has been raised to $170 billion (up from the previous $107 billion forecast), driven by higher CPU-to-GPU ratio assumptions for AI inference servers. > CPU-to-GPU Ratios: The CPU-to-GPU ratio on AI servers is accelerating and is expected to approach 1:1 by the end of 2027 or 2028. Supply Chain & Technical Bottlenecks > DRAM Constraints: A critical bottleneck exists in DDR5/LPDDR5 supply, with a projected fulfillment ratio of only 70% over the next 12–18 months. > Demand vs. Supply Gap: Based on current models, the 2027 demand for DDR5/LPDDR5X (over 300 billion 1Gb equivalents) significantly exceeds the projected supply (220–250 billion 1Gb equivalents). > Potential Risks: The shortage of key materials—DRAM, substrates, and passives—is expected to persist through 2027 and could pose downside risks to downstream server assemblers, potentially leading to lower server rack output. Key Player Insights (2027 Forecasts) > Nvidia: Expected to reach 5.0–6.0 million units for the Vera CPU, including 2.0–3.0 million units specifically for agentic AI stack racks. > Google: Axion CPU production is projected to increase more than 2x year-over-year, aligning with the growth trajectory of TPU units. > AMD: The N2 Venice CPU is forecasted to exceed 6.0 million units. GPUs/ASICs Market Growth Projections > Rapid Expansion: The total AI ASIC market is projected to grow from 4.1 million units in 2025 to 24.0 million units by 2028. > Volume Drivers: The growth is driven by substantial increases in deployment by major hyperscalers including Google, Amazon (Annapurna), Meta, Microsoft, and OpenAI. > External Demand: The market for external (non-Google) AI ASIC units is expected to surge from 0.6 million in 2025 to 7.2 million by 2028. Key Hyperscaler Activity > Google (TPU): Continues to be a dominant player, with total shipment units increasing from 2.5 million in 2025 to 7.1 million by 2028. > Anthropic: Significant ramp-up is forecasted for their "TPU Ironwood/Sunfish" chips, moving from 0.6 million units in 2026 to 6.2 million units by 2028. > Amazon/Annapurna: Shipments for the Trainium line are projected to double from 1.5 million in 2025 to 3.6 million by 2028. > Meta: Rapid scaling of MTIA chips is expected, growing from 0.1 million units in 2025 to 2.7 million units by 2028. Technical Trends > Advanced Packaging & Nodes: There is a heavy reliance on sophisticated packaging technologies like CoWoS-L and CoWoS-S, and advanced foundry nodes including N2, N3, N4, N5, and A16. > HBM Integration: Nearly all listed high-performance ASICs utilize High Bandwidth Memory (HBM), with a transition toward newer generations such as HBM3E and HBM4/4E to meet performance demands. > ASP Variance: Average Selling Prices (ASP) range significantly, from approximately $2,000 for entry-level models to as high as $40,000 for top-tier specialized chips like the TPUv10. $DRAM $EWY $MU $GOOGL $AMKR $TSM $ASE $NVDA $AMD $AVGO $MRVL $INTC $MSFT $META
BofA: Kimi 3 The Kimi K3 Release & The Compute Race > New Chinese Open-Weight Model: Moonshot has unveiled Kimi K3, a massive 2.8-trillion-parameter Mixture of Experts (MoE) model with a 1-million-token context window. > U.S. Labs Pressured to Scale: With Chinese open-weight models closing the gap and media reports suggesting Google’s Gemini 3.5 Pro is months behind schedule, U.S. frontier labs (OpenAI, Anthropic, Google) must increase compute. They will need larger training runs, heavier reinforcement learning (RL), synthetic-data loops, and faster release cadences to stay ahead. > Business Over Leaderboards: Investors are cautioned not to confuse benchmark leadership with sustainable business models. The durable moat in enterprise AI is delivering accurate, low-latency, and high-uptime AI at the lowest cost. Bullish Outlook for AI Semiconductors > MoE Architectures Boost Hardware Demand: The shift toward Mixture of Experts (MoE) architectures highlights the critical importance of memory movement, routing, latency, and interconnects. > NVIDIA's Next-Gen Efficiency: NVIDIA's GB300 NVL72 provides up to a 25x performance-per-watt improvement over Hopper when serving leading open MoE models. > Expanding Silicon Demand: Open models are inherently bullish for semiconductors. Even as model value commoditizes, the infrastructure demands for GPUs, High-Bandwidth Memory (HBM), networking, and efficient inference will continue to expand. > EDA Resilience: BofA remains constructive on Electronic Design Automation (EDA) players like Cadence (CDNS) and Synopsys (SNPS). Despite mentions of "open-source EDA at 45nm" in Kimi K3, commercial EDA tools remain entirely mandatory for major foundries like TSMC to manufacture advanced chips. Surging Token Usage & Enterprise AI Adoption > Chinese Labs Leading Token Volume: Data from OpenRouter shows that weekly token usage is proliferating rapidly, with daily token usage on Chinese AI models now exceeding that of Western AI labs. > US Enterprise Adoption Rates: According to the Ramp AI Index, approximately 55% of US businesses now have paid subscriptions to AI tools (significantly higher than the US Census estimate of 21%). > Market Share & Spending: Anthropic leads enterprise model adoption at 42.4%, closely followed by OpenAI at 39.5%. While the median monthly AI spend per employee is just $11, the top 1% of enterprise spenders are averaging a massive $4,833 per employee monthly. $CDNS $NVDA $GOOGL $SNPS
BofA: Google $GOOGL Earnings Preview 2Q'26 Financial Estimates vs. Consensus > Net Revenue: Estimated at $102.1bn (up 25% y/y) vs. Street consensus of $101.0bn. > GAAP EPS: Estimated at $8.38 vs. Street consensus of $2.90. > Other Income Benefit: BofA's significantly higher EPS estimate includes a $80bn one-time mark-to-market benefit from the revaluation of Alphabet’s stake in Anthropic (Anthropic's valuation reportedly surged from $380bn in 1Q to $965bn in 2Q) Segment Performance & Model Revisions > Google Cloud Strength: BofA raised its 2Q Google Cloud growth estimate to 70% y/y ($23.2bn in revenue) driven by accelerating AI demand and a strong backlog. Anthropic has reportedly committed to spending $200bn on Google Cloud over the next 5 years. > Google Search: Expected to grow 17% y/y to $63.6bn. Strong retail search growth is being slightly offset by softness in travel and consumer packaged goods (CPG), alongside minor FX headwinds. > YouTube Advertising: Estimated at $10.8bn (up 10% y/y), which is inline with the Street. Growth is decelerating modestly due to tougher comparisons and automated tools (like PMax) shifting client budgets to Search. > Long-term Revisions (Full Year 2026): Net revenue estimates were raised by 1% to $427bn and full-year EPS estimates increased by 36% to $19.70. Capex Expansion & Infrastructure Leases > Capital Expenditures: BofA notes that higher component pricing (e.g., memory/DRAM) and accelerating AI demand could push Google to increase its CY26 capex range by ~5% to $190–$200bn (BofA models $196bn). 2Q capex is modeled at $50.1bn (up 123% y/y). > SpaceX GPU Lease: On June 5, 2026, Alphabet entered a multi-year agreement to lease 110,000 NVIDIA GPUs from SpaceX, committing to a payment of ~$920mn per month from October 2026 through June 2029 to secure immediate capacity. > Massive Capital Raise: Alphabet raised $85bn in capital ($44.75bn in equity capital/strategic investment and a planned $40bn ATM equity program) alongside issuing $17bn in Euro and Canadian dollar debt to fund AI infrastructure and tax obligations.

Switzerland has launched an antitrust investigation into Alphabet $GOOGL over its sudden removal of the Android search choice screen. THE SQUEEZE: Regulators are probing if cutting the setup prompt—which remains active across the EU—unlawfully blocks rival search visibility and forces Google as the default. This comes right after Google lost its appeal against a record €4.1B EU antitrust fine.
